Transaction: 18f77cacf99677fae15b0602e4219dd683894e0920070980a843d753fad46d48

Block Hash: 00000009d1777881a409510dafde943535e98b2f95286618e2a1ebd0de8da3fa

Confirmations: 2995513

Timestamp: 2017-06-12 17:13:00

Amount: 15.63

Is Block Reward: Yes

Reward Type: PoW

Inputs

Sender Address Amount
Coinbase ( PoW) 15.63

Outputs

Recipient Address Amount
SfPdTEtsxcNwPbzuHzJn9Tp6GzijX4944P 15.63